Frequently Asked Questions about Upper Nyack

How much are Studio apartments in Upper Nyack?

There are currently 7 Studio Apartments in Upper Nyack with rent ranges from $1,725 to $1,725 with an average price of $1,725.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Upper Nyack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Upper Nyack ranges from $1,775 to $2,975 with an average monthly rent of $2,393.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Upper Nyack c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Upper Nyack range from $2,100 to $3,995.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,909.

How expensive are Upper Nyack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 6 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Upper Nyack on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$3,200 to $3,650 - averaging $3,425 for the location.
